Step 1: Gathering Your Memories

Begin by jotting down everything you recall about the video. Even the vaguest memory can be a valuable clue. Consider these questions:

  • Do any lyrics come to mind?
  • Can you remember the genre or era of the song?
  • Are any specific scenes or actors that stood out?
  • Was there a unique aspect to the video – like a dance move or costume?

Step 2: Leveraging Search Engines

Utilize search engines like Google. Enter any lyrics or descriptive phrases you remember. If you’re unsure, include probable genres or timeframes. For instance, typing “early 2000s pop song, beach party scene” can yield surprisingly accurate results.

Step 3: Exploring YouTube’s Depths

YouTube is a treasure trove for music video seekers. Use specific keywords and utilize YouTube’s advanced search filters, such as the upload date or video length, to narrow your search.

Step 4: Advanced Google Search Techniques

Don’t overlook Google’s advanced search capabilities. Specify phrases, filter by time periods, or focus on particular websites known for music content. This refined approach can lead to more precise results.

Step 5: Song Identification Apps

Apps like Shazam or SoundHound can be instrumental. Hum or sing a portion of the tune, and these apps will attempt to identify the song, leading you closer to the music video.

Step 6: Diving into Discographies

If you recall the artist, explore their discography. Streaming services like Spotify or Apple Music categorize songs by artist and album, making it easier to pinpoint the video.

Step 7: Engaging with Music Communities

Online communities on platforms like Reddit or specialized forums can be invaluable resources. Describe the video as best as possible and engage with fellow music enthusiasts for insights.

Step 8: Consulting Personal Networks

Sometimes, a simple conversation with friends or family can jog your memory. Share your recollections and see if they recall the music video.
